New Jersey Statutes
§ 17:16C-67 — Separate disclosure statements in contract
New Jersey·Title 17 CORPORATIONS AND INSTITUTIONS FOR FINANCE AND INSURANCE
6.
(a)Every home repair contract shall state separately:
(1)the cash price of the goods or services to be furnished;
(2)the down payment;
(3)the unpaid cash balance which is the difference between paragraphs (1) and (2) of this subsection (a);
(4)the amount, if any, if a separate charge is made therefor, included for credit life insurance and other benefits pursuant to N.J.S.17B:29-1 et seq., specifying the coverages and benefits;
(5)the official fees;
(6)the principal balance, which is the sum of paragraphs (3), (4) and (5) of this subsection (a);
(7)the credit service charge;
(8)the time balance, which is the sum of paragraphs (6) and (7) of this subsection (a), the number of installments required, the amount of each installment and the due dates thereof;
